Sobre este artículo
FIRST BRITISH EDITION! London: Vision Press; 1st British Edition (1949). Hardcover (DimGray cloth, Gilt lettering). no dj. Minimal rubbing to the edges. No Wear. Clean unmarked throughout. Strong tight binding, excellent hinges. 7.4"x5.0"x1.5". be25521
